net: ethernet: macb: Add support for rx_clk
authorshubhrajyoti.datta@xilinx.com <shubhrajyoti.datta@xilinx.com>
Tue, 16 Aug 2016 04:44:50 +0000 (10:14 +0530)
committerDavid S. Miller <davem@davemloft.net>
Fri, 19 Aug 2016 03:58:42 +0000 (20:58 -0700)
commitaead88bd0e990540c03df8108671c93b35354736
treeb74ba246bf7717f032439c66b7c773288866f12c
parentd52bfbda774a9996e0687511ab7a9cd67d195d05
net: ethernet: macb: Add support for rx_clk

Some of the platforms like zynqmp ultrascale+ has a
separate clock gate for the rx clock. Add an optional
rx_clk so that the clock can be enabled.

Signed-off-by: Shubhrajyoti Datta <shubhrajyoti.datta@xilinx.com>
Acked-by: Nicolas Ferre <nicolas.ferre@atmel.com>
Acked-by: Rob Herring <robh@kernel.org>
Signed-off-by: David S. Miller <davem@davemloft.net>
Documentation/devicetree/bindings/net/macb.txt
drivers/net/ethernet/cadence/macb.c
drivers/net/ethernet/cadence/macb.h